Well, if you have the imagination and skill of Etsy crafter Screaming Chee Toes, it will look like this fantastically giant plarn rug. Plarn is a type of yarn made out of plastic grocery bags. This is upcycling in it's truest form -- taking something of absolutely no value and transforming it into something with an inherently high value!
I can't begin to imagine how many hours were spent crocheting this gorgeous rug which can both indoors and outdoors. Hundreds of yards of yarn was also woven into the design. The resulting rug aptly entitled Living Large measures in at 5 x 7 feet!
This rug is more than just planet friendly though, it's also foot friendly! One would imagine that the repurposed plastic bags would be crunchy or crinkly under the feet but the crafter says that it is soft and tender on the toes.

Imagine how fantastic this rug would look in a main entranceway. The rug naturally creates static which helps to trap dust. This could make for a much tidier front entranceway!
